Cash Only Bonds and Surety Bail Bonds
In Indiana, various bond types exist, such as cash-only bonds and surety bail bonds. A cash-only bond requires the full payment of the bond amount in cash. Conversely, a surety bail bond means a bondsman ensures the entire bond amount for a fee, typically 10% of the bond.
If a cash bond is necessary, make sure to find a “cash-only bondsman” in your area. This bond type can be simpler but demands immediate cash payment.
